Note: You can only go as far as the second floor via the stairs. There are 674 steps to reach the second floor. Adults $12.30 (11.30 €) ... WebEiffel Tower Stairs. The Eiffel Tower has 4 staircases, one for each pillar, going from the ground floor to the second floor. There’s a fifth staircase that goes up from the second floor to the summit. Re: Steps in Eiffel Tower - how many. thanks for the info. should not be any problem whatsoever. cant wait. WebThere are a total of 1,665 Eiffel Tower Stairs, from the ground to the top. However, you can only access the stairs up to the second floor, which are divided into 327 and 347 each from the ground to the first floor, and then from the first to the second floor. Stairs from the second floor to the top are not open to the public for safety reasons.
